Condominium building located in Bedford is recruiting for an experienced part-time Building Superintendent / Cleaner
We are seeking an exceptional Building Superintendent and Cleaner to maintain the cleanliness and functioning of the common areas of the corporation, and overseeing the contracted services such as snow removal and landscaping, system repairs and general maintenance. The successful candidate will contribute to the quality and living experience of our residents with a positive attitude and pro-active approach.
The person we are seeking should have minimum of 3 years’ experience with residential building systems as well as knowledge of cleaning products, good communication skills and an excellent work ethic.
This is a part-time position. The successful candidate will be required to work approx. 20 hours per week - Monday to Friday (approximately 9:00am - 1:00pm) as well as be available on call for afterhours for emergencies.

Cleaning tasks – All areas of the building are to be maintained with the highest cleaning standards to prevent damage, rodents, or other pests.
- Garbage room floor to be mopped daily.
- Vacuum hallways, wash windows, interior walls, sweep/mop stairs, handrails and maintain mechanical hallway on a set schedule.
- Maintain all common areas. Front and rear entrance windows and hand pulls to be cleaned daily.
- Empty trash cans and other waste containers that are located around the building’s interior.
- Sweep, mop, scrub hallways, floors, and stairs on a weekly schedule.
Daily walking of parking area and surrounding grounds to pick up debris, garbage, and use the leaf blower to remove excess leaves, grass etc.
- In the winter, notify residents as to when the plows are coming to ensure that the parking lot is properly cleared front and back.
- In the summer, review the work of the ground maintenance crews have completed a sufficient job and have cleaned up the cuttings before leaving the property.
Review the checklist to see what additional tasks need to be completed, or issues that have been submitted on paper or through the portal by residents.
To become familiar with and monitor the following building systems:
- Intercom system.
- Emergency lighting to be tested monthly.
- Corridor ventilation.
- Interior/exterior lighting and electrical timers and /or photocells.
- Monthly Fire alarms systems notification and testing.
- Sprinkler systems.
- Monthly Inspection of Fire extinguishers.
- Operation of boilers and associated equipment.
- Washers, dryers and payment terminals.
- Building laptop and routers.
